29 Catalyst::Request - Catalyst Request Class
41 $req->body_parameters;
42 $req->content_encoding;
58 $req->query_parameters;
73 This is the Catalyst Request class, which provides a set of accessors to the
74 request data. The request object is prepared by the specialized Catalyst
75 Engine module thus hiding the details of the particular engine implementation.

379 =item $req->read( [$maxlength] )
381 Read a chunk of data from the request body. This method is designed to be
382 used in a while loop, reading $maxlength bytes on every call. $maxlength
383 defaults to the size of the request if not specified.
385 You have to set MyApp->config->{parse_on_demand} to use this directly.
